Cardinal Health, Inc. distributes pharmaceuticals and specialty products and manufactures and distributes medical, laboratory, home-health and direct-to-patient products and services. The company also operates nuclear pharmacies and manufacturing facilities and provides performance and data solutions for healthcare customers.

Cardinal Health (NYSE: CAH) has elected Sheri Edison as an independent director, effective September 1, 2020. With extensive experience as a legal executive in medical devices and packaging, Ms. Edison aims to enhance the board's capabilities in legal, regulatory compliance, and corporate governance. Currently serving as General Counsel for Amcor, she has held senior positions at Bemis and Hill-Rom Holdings. Her appointment brings valuable insight to the board, complementing current expertise in healthcare.
Cardinal Health (NYSE: CAH) reported Q4 FY2020 revenues of $36.7 billion, down 2% year-over-year, with GAAP operating earnings of $270 million. The COVID-19 pandemic negatively impacted earnings by approximately $130 million. Fiscal year revenues rose 5% to $152.9 billion, but the company reported a GAAP operating loss of $4.1 billion primarily due to opioid litigation. Non-GAAP EPS for Q4 was $1.04, slightly down from last year. For FY2021, non-GAAP EPS guidance is between $5.25 - $5.65, accounting for continued COVID-19 headwinds.

Cardinal Health (NYSE: CAH) announced the election of David C. Evans as an independent director, effective July 1. Mr. Evans brings extensive financial expertise and operational experience, having served as interim CFO of Cardinal Health and CFO at Battelle Memorial Institute and Scotts MiracleGro. His board roles include positions at Scotts MiracleGro and the Siegel Rare Neuroimmune Association. The board chair, Gregory Kenny, expressed confidence in Evans' leadership during periods of change, emphasizing the importance of his insights for future growth strategies.
